Houthi attacks reportedly kill at least 30 Yemeni government forces

The Spin


The Houthi militia's missile and drone strikes that killed at least 30 Yemeni soldiers in Marib and Hadramout were a premeditated act of terrorism backed by Iran — not a defensive response. These were Yemeni soldiers fulfilling their constitutional duty, not foreign forces, and dressing up the slaughter as justified resistance is a flat-out lie. The Houthis have always needed an enemy to distract from their own failures governing the people under their control.

Saudi Arabia has kept Yemen under a crushing siege, and the strikes on military camps in Marib and Hadramout were a direct military response to a large Saudi-backed buildup aimed at escalating against Yemeni territory. Sanaa has now established a firm deterrence equation — any Saudi military movement toward Yemen will be targeted. Ending the blockade on the Yemeni people is the only path to stopping further escalation.
